High School Internships

 

PROGRAM OVERVIEW
This internship is a formal, comprehensive program designed for selected candidates to gain valuable experience in their field of interest with Easton Utilities. Each selected participant will receive daily responsibilities.

 

JOB DESCRIPTION
During their time with Easton Utilities, interns will work alongside coworkers to acquire the skills necessary to perform daily departmental tasks. To culminate the internship, each participant will present a project to their department and supervising staff. Candidates must possess time management skills; including the necessity to establish a project timeline, a feasible project scope, and the ability to conduct a professional presentation at the end of the program. Easton Utilities works closely with Talbot County Public Schools CTE or vocational programs to help students gain necessary skills to meet requirements.

 

CANDIDATE REQUIREMENTS

  • Must be entering their Junior or Senior year of a Talbot County High School, or recent graduate.
  • Minimum GPA of 2.80.
  • Working knowledge of Microsoft Office suite.
  • The ability to work and thrive within a team-oriented environment.
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ills.
  • Ability to work a minimum of 24 hours and up to 40 hours per week.
  • Schedule changes must be provided to supervisor at least two (2) weeks in advance.
  • All offers are contingent on a pre-employment drug test and background check.
